Asking Alexandria drop two new songs, “Psycho” and “Bad Blood”

Author Flavia Andrade - 16.6.2023

Asking Alexandria will release their eighth full-length studio effort, “Where Do We Go From Here?”, this fall via Better Noise Music. The first track from it, “Dark Void“, was released in May. Now, the band has shared the album’s first official radio single “Psycho” alongside “Bad Blood” across digital platforms.

In guitarist Ben Bruce’s words:

Psycho‘ is one of those songs that is talking about when you feel trapped inside your own head, trapped by your own vices and your own downfall. Whether it’s being stuck in a relationship that doesn’t work for you, or feeling like you can’t stop drinking or doing drugs, or maybe you’re stuck in a job that you hate, and you’re just battling yourself in your own head wondering ‘why am I still here? Why do I keep doing these things?’ Ultimately, at the end of the day we all feel a little bit crazy…a little bit like a psycho. It’s just a fun song that we can all relate to, and stylistically we thought to ourselves ‘how do we make a song that sounds like it could live on the ‘Like A House On Fire’ album, but also like it could live on the ‘From Death To Destiny’ album?’. So musically, from a writing standpoint, it was a really enjoyable experience to meld those two eras of Asking Alexandria together and see what that might look like.
